SummaryLooking for a nursing role that offers meaningful patient connections, a supportive team environment, and an excellent work-life balance? UNC Health's Multispecialty Surgery Clinic is seeking an experienced and compassionate Clinical Nurse II to join our growing team.
In this role, you'll provide direct patient care, support minor in-office procedures, educate patients and families, and collaborate closely with surgeons, advanced practice providers, and interdisciplinary team members across multiple surgical specialties.
